Green chicken curry is a popular Indian chicken curry. This is a mildly spiced chicken curry with star ingredient coriander leaves or cilantro. Get step by step pictures and video recipe to make Goan style green chicken recipe.

Goan Green masala chicken curry is very easy to cook. This chicken recipe is like chicken cafreal but is completely different. The Indian green chicken curry is mildly spiced with heat from green chili and other spice powders added for bringing out the flavours. Green colour and aromatic flavour are from coriander leaves.

Green chicken curry

This curry green chicken recipe can also be called as coriander chicken curry. The curry has a subtle flavour of coriander, garlic, ginger and other spices.

Ingredients to make easy green chicken curry:

  • Chicken: Chicken with bone-in or boneless can be used to make this coriander chicken curry.
  • Coriander leaves: Coriander leaves or cilantro is the star ingredient which adds green colour and aromatic flavour to the curry. Use fresh brunch of coriander leaves. While making the coriander paste, the stem can also be added while grinding.
  • Onion: Medium sized red onion should be added to this chicken recipe.
  • Tomato: Tomatoes add tanginess to the curry. Use fresh firm ripe tomatoes in this recipe.
  • Ginger-garlic paste: Paste made by crushing ยผ inch ginger and 6 pods garlic using mortar and pestle
  • Green chili: Green chili adds heat in the recipe. Quantity can be increased or decreased as per your taste.
  • Spice powders: Black pepper powder, coriander powder, cumin powder and cinnamon powder are the spice powders which add flavour to the recipe.

Green Chicken Curry

Green chicken curry is a popular Indian chicken curry. This is a mildly spiced chicken curry with star ingredient coriander leaves or cilantro.
Prep Time1 hour hr
Cook Time40 minutes mins
Servings: 4 People
By: Raksha Kamat
Prevent your screen from going dark

Ingredients

  • 7-10 pieces of chicken
  • 8 garlic pods finely chopped
  • 2 tablespoon ginger-garlic paste made by crushing ยผ inch ginger and 6 pods garlic using mortar and pestle
  • 2 medium sized onion finely chopped
  • 1 tomato finely chopped
  • 2 tablespoon green chilli sauce
  • 1 teaspoon black pepper powder
  • 1 tablespoon coriander powder
  • 1 teaspoon cumin powder
  • 1 teaspoon cinnamon powder
  • 3 tablespoon oil

For the gravy:

  • 1 bunch of fresh coriander leaves chopped along with the stem or 2 cups chopped coriander leaves
  • 3 green chillies
  • 10 pods garlic
  • 1/2 inch ginger
  • 5 peppercorns
  • 4 tablespoon oil

For Marination:

  • 1 tablespoon turmeric powder
  • 2 tablespoon coriander leaves
  • 1/2 inch ginger
  • 4-5 garlic pods
  • 1 tablespoon lime juice
  • ยฝ teaspoon salt

Instructions

For marinating chicken:

  • Make a thick paste with coriander leaves, ginger and garlic (check ingredients in marination section).
  • Apply this to chicken along with turmeric powder, lime juice and salt.
  • Keep it in fridge to marinate for 1 hour.

To make green chicken gravy:

  • Grind the following ingredients to make green gravy by adding 1/4 cup water โ€“ bunch of coriander leaves, green chillies, garlic, ginger and peppercorns to a smooth thick paste.

To make green chicken curry:

  • Heat a kadai and add little oil.
  • Add the chopped onion and fry till it gets pinkish.
  • Then add ginger-garlic paste and fry for 1 minute.
  • Add finely chopped garlic and fry for few seconds.
  • Next add chopped tomato and fry on low flame by closing the lid of the kadai/pan till the tomato gets mushy.
  • Add green chili sauce and mix well.
  • Add the spice powders โ€“ cinnamon powder, coriander powder, cumin powder and black pepper powder and mix well.
  • Add the prepared green paste and mix well. Let it cook for 5 minutes.
  • Add the chicken pieces. Stir and close the lid of the kadai/pan.
  • Add stock cube and mix well. (This is optional)
  • After some time, check if chicken is cooked by trying to cut open a small piece of chicken while it is getting cooked in the kadai. If chicken is cooked properly then you will notice pieces separating easily.
  • Adjust the salt and switch off the flame.
  • Serve with rice or rotis.
